It is a truth universally acknowledged that the literary online love to complain, and the objects of their ire this week are these heinous young adult covers of Jane Austen classics. Puffin, Penguin UK’s children’s imprint, has released a series of brightly colored Austen covers, featuring Gen-Z renderings of her famous protagonists. They’re calling the series “First Impressions” and purposefully gearing it toward young readers with forewords by famous BookTok romance authors like Ali Hazelwood.

A Former Survivor player facing off against a former Bachelor for $250,000? Alan Cumming parading around a Scottish castle? Cumming buries them alive, covers them in bugs, and forces them to scour for shields to protect from “murder” in this 10-episode series. I would sum up Peacock’s The Traitors in one word: absurd — and obviously, it hooked me immediately. Based on the Danish show of the same name, The Traitors pits reality TV stars against each other in a game show version of Mafia.
